自己写了一篇才知道,原来的理解是错误的
并不是high指针和low指针交换,而是直接赋值
一直理解错误,郁闷。

#include <stdio.h>
#define SIZE_OF_ARRAY(x) (sizeof(x)/sizeof(x[0]))
void print_array(int array[], int len)
{
//printf("%d\n", SIZE_OF_ARRAY(array)); 结果为指针大小,数组退化为指针
int i = 0;
for(i = 0; i < len; i++)
{
printf("%d ", array[i]);
}
printf("\n");
return;
}
int partition(int array[], int low, int high)
{
printf("low = %d, high = %d\n", low, high);
print_array(array, 9);
int base_num = array[low]; //这里不是array[0], 不能只注意第一次
while(low < high)
{
while((low < high) && (array[high] > base_num))
{
high--;
}
array[low] = array[high];
print_array(array, 9);
while((low < high) && (array[low] < base_num))
{
low++;
}
array[high] = array[low];
print_array(array, 9);
}
array[low] = base_num;
print_array(array, 9);
printf("\n");
return low;
}
void quick_sort(int array[], int low, int high)
{
int part_num = 0;
if(low < high)
{
part_num = partition(array, low, high);
quick_sort(array, low, part_num - 1);
quick_sort(array, part_num + 1, high);
}
}
int main()
{
int array[] = {7, 5, 9, 6, 2, 11, 4, 24, 3};
// int array[] = {1,2,3,4,5,6,7,8,9};
int low = 0;
int high = SIZE_OF_ARRAY(array) - 1;
quick_sort(array, low, high);
return 0;
}
